Call for Nominations For the Best Article Prize
Best Article on the History of Children and Youth Published in Calendar Year 2007 or 2008
The Society for the History of Children and Youth (SHCY) is pleased to call for nominations for the best article in English on the history of children, childhood, or youth (broadly construed) published in calendar year 2007 or 2008 in a print or on-line journal. The award of a plaque and a check for $250US will be presented at the SHCY Biennial Conference, at the University of California-Berkeley, Berkeley, California, July 10-12, 2009. Nominations are invited from journals, writers (self-nominations), and scholars. All are eligible for the award, except for current members of the award committee and the executive committee and officers of the SHCY. Nominations must be postmarked by Feb. 15, 2009.
